  • Protecting Your Investment: The Importance Of Fine Art Business Insurance

    Fine art has always been a valuable commodity, both in terms of its cultural significance and its financial worth. For those involved in the art world – from galleries and museums to collectors and artists – protecting these valuable assets is crucial. This is where fine art business insurance comes into play, providing a safety net in the event of unforeseen circumstances.

    fine art business insurance is a specialized type of insurance that is designed to protect art dealers, galleries, museums, collectors, and artists from the unique risks associated with the art world. These risks can include damage to artworks, theft, vandalism, and loss of income due to unforeseen events such as a fire or a natural disaster.

    One of the key reasons why fine art business insurance is important is the sheer value of the artworks involved. Fine art can command prices in the millions of dollars, making it a highly lucrative target for theft or damage. In the event of a loss, having the right insurance coverage can mean the difference between financial ruin and being able to recover and move forward.

    Another reason why fine art business insurance is essential is the unique nature of the art world. Unlike other types of businesses, art dealers, galleries, and museums often have artworks on loan, in transit, or on display in multiple locations. This can create a complex web of risks that traditional insurance policies may not adequately cover. fine art business insurance is designed to address these specific needs, providing coverage for artwork in transit, on loan, and on display.

    There are several types of fine art business insurance policies available, each tailored to meet the specific needs of the art world. These can include:

    1. Art dealers insurance: This type of policy is designed to protect art dealers from the risks associated with owning and selling artworks. It can provide coverage for damage to artworks, theft, and loss of income due to unforeseen events.

    2. Gallery insurance: Galleries often have artworks on display that can be damaged or stolen. Gallery insurance provides coverage for these risks, as well as for liability issues that may arise from visitors to the gallery.

    3. Museum insurance: Museums house valuable collections that are often irreplaceable. Museum insurance provides coverage for damage to artworks, theft, and loss of income due to unforeseen events.

    4. Collector insurance: Collectors often have valuable artworks in their homes that may not be adequately covered by traditional homeowners insurance. Collector insurance provides coverage for these risks, as well as for liability issues that may arise from owning valuable artworks.

    In addition to these specific types of insurance policies, there are also specialty insurance providers that cater specifically to the art world. These providers understand the unique risks associated with the art world and can tailor policies to meet the individual needs of their clients.

    When considering fine art business insurance, it is important to work with a reputable insurance provider that has experience in the art world. This can help ensure that you have the right coverage for your specific needs and that you are adequately protected in the event of a loss.

    In conclusion, fine art business insurance is a crucial tool for protecting the valuable assets of those involved in the art world. Whether you are an art dealer, gallery owner, museum curator, collector, or artist, having the right insurance coverage can provide peace of mind and financial security in the event of unforeseen circumstances. By working with a reputable insurance provider that specializes in the art world, you can ensure that your investments are protected and that you can continue to thrive in the vibrant world of fine art.

  • Investing Socially Responsible: Making A Positive Impact With Your Investments

    In recent years, there has been a growing trend towards socially responsible investing. This approach to investing takes into consideration not only the financial return on an investment but also the social and environmental impact it has. Investors are increasingly looking for ways to align their values with their investment choices, and socially responsible investing provides a way to do just that.

    So what exactly is socially responsible investing? At its core, socially responsible investing involves investing in companies that are committed to making a positive impact on society and the environment. This can take many forms, from investing in companies that promote sustainability and environmental stewardship to avoiding companies involved in practices such as child labor or environmental pollution.

    One of the key benefits of socially responsible investing is that it allows investors to use their money to support causes they believe in. By investing in companies that are socially responsible, investors can help promote positive change and contribute to a more sustainable and equitable world. This can be especially rewarding for investors who are passionate about certain social or environmental issues and want to make a difference through their investment choices.

    Another benefit of socially responsible investing is that it can also be financially rewarding. Studies have shown that companies that prioritize social and environmental responsibility often outperform their peers in the long run. This is because these companies tend to have strong corporate governance, better risk management practices, and a solid reputation with consumers. By investing in these companies, investors can potentially earn higher returns while also making a positive impact.

    There are many different ways to incorporate socially responsible investing into your investment strategy. One common approach is to invest in mutual funds or exchange-traded funds (ETFs) that focus on socially responsible companies. These funds typically screen companies based on their social and environmental practices, allowing investors to support companies that align with their values.

    Another approach is to engage in shareholder activism, where investors use their ownership stake in companies to push for positive change. This can include advocating for companies to adopt more sustainable practices or improve their social impact. By actively engaging with companies to promote social responsibility, investors can have a direct impact on the companies they invest in.

    Some investors also choose to invest directly in companies that align with their values. For example, an investor who is passionate about environmental sustainability may choose to invest in renewable energy companies or companies that have strong environmental policies. By investing directly in these companies, investors can have a more targeted impact on the issues they care about.

    One common misconception about socially responsible investing is that it requires sacrificing returns in order to make a positive impact. However, this is not necessarily the case. In fact, many socially responsible investments have been shown to deliver competitive returns compared to traditional investments. By investing in companies that are well-managed and have a strong commitment to social responsibility, investors can potentially achieve both financial and social returns.

    It’s also worth noting that socially responsible investing is not just a trend – it’s a growing movement that is here to stay. As consumers become more conscious of the social and environmental impact of their purchasing decisions, companies are under increasing pressure to adopt more sustainable practices. This shift towards sustainability is driving demand for socially responsible investments and creating new opportunities for investors to make a positive impact.

    In conclusion, investing socially responsible is not only a way to align your investments with your values, but also a way to potentially earn competitive returns while making a positive impact on society and the environment. Whether you choose to invest in socially responsible mutual funds, engage in shareholder activism, or invest directly in companies that align with your values, there are many ways to incorporate social responsibility into your investment strategy. By investing with a focus on social and environmental impact, you can help create a more sustainable and equitable world while also achieving your financial goals.

  • The Versatility And Strength Of Large Metal Tubing

    large metal tubing is a key component in a wide range of industries, offering unrivaled strength and versatility for countless applications. From construction to aerospace, automotive to manufacturing, large metal tubing plays a crucial role in modern engineering and design. In this article, we will explore the characteristics, uses, and benefits of large metal tubing, highlighting why it is a preferred choice for so many industries.

    One of the defining features of large metal tubing is its strength and durability. Made from materials such as steel, aluminum, or stainless steel, large metal tubing can withstand immense pressure, making it ideal for applications where structural integrity is paramount. Whether supporting heavy loads in construction projects or carrying high-pressure fluids in industrial systems, large metal tubing provides the strength and reliability needed to get the job done.

    In addition to its strength, large metal tubing is also highly versatile. Available in a wide range of shapes, sizes, and configurations, large metal tubing can be customized to meet the specific requirements of any project. From round to square, rectangular to oval, large metal tubing can be shaped to fit a variety of applications, making it a flexible and adaptable choice for engineers and designers.

    large metal tubing is used in a diverse range of industries, each with its own unique requirements and challenges. In the construction industry, large metal tubing is commonly used in structural applications such as building frames, roof trusses, and scaffolding. Its strength and durability make it an ideal choice for supporting heavy loads and withstanding harsh environmental conditions.

    In the automotive industry, large metal tubing is used in the fabrication of exhaust systems, chassis components, and roll cages. Its ability to withstand high temperatures and resist corrosion make it an essential material for automotive manufacturers looking to build safe and reliable vehicles.

    large metal tubing is also widely used in the manufacturing industry, where it serves as a key component in various machines and equipment. Whether transporting liquids and gases through processing systems or supporting conveyor belts and production lines, large metal tubing plays a crucial role in keeping manufacturing operations running smoothly and efficiently.

    The aerospace industry relies heavily on large metal tubing for the construction of aircraft frames, engine components, and hydraulic systems. The lightweight yet strong properties of materials such as aluminum make large metal tubing an ideal choice for aerospace applications, where minimizing weight and maximizing strength are essential for safe and efficient flight.

    The benefits of large metal tubing extend beyond its strength and versatility. Large metal tubing is also highly cost-effective, offering a durable and long-lasting solution for a wide range of applications. Its ability to withstand extreme conditions and harsh environments means that it requires minimal maintenance and replacement, reducing overall costs and downtime for businesses and industries.

    Large metal tubing is also environmentally friendly, as it can be recycled and reused multiple times without compromising its strength or integrity. This sustainability factor makes large metal tubing an attractive choice for companies looking to reduce their environmental impact and carbon footprint.

    In conclusion, large metal tubing is a crucial component in many industries, offering unrivaled strength, versatility, and durability for countless applications. From construction to aerospace, automotive to manufacturing, large metal tubing plays a vital role in modern engineering and design, providing a reliable and cost-effective solution for businesses and industries around the world. Whether supporting heavy loads, transporting fluids, or withstanding extreme conditions, large metal tubing is a versatile and indispensable material that continues to drive innovation and progress in a wide range of industries.

  • The Benefits Of Using Heat Timer Automatic Heating Control

    Heating systems are essential for maintaining a comfortable indoor environment, especially during the colder months. However, inefficient heating systems can lead to skyrocketing energy costs and uneven temperature distribution throughout a building. That’s where heat timer automatic heating control comes in to save the day.

    Heat Timer automatic heating control is a smart solution that allows users to regulate their heating systems more effectively and efficiently. By utilizing advanced technology, these systems can adjust the temperature based on occupancy levels, outside weather conditions, and other factors. This not only helps to create a more comfortable living or working environment but also saves energy and reduces heating costs.

    One of the main benefits of using heat timer automatic heating control is its ability to optimize energy usage. Traditional heating systems operate on a set schedule, regardless of whether the building is occupied or not. This can lead to unnecessary energy consumption and higher utility bills. In contrast, heat timer systems can adjust the temperature based on occupancy levels. For example, the system can lower the temperature during off-peak hours or when the building is vacant, and raise it back to a comfortable level when people return. This ensures that energy is only used when needed, resulting in significant cost savings.

    Another advantage of heat timer automatic heating control is its ability to adapt to changing weather conditions. External factors, such as sunlight, wind, and temperature fluctuations, can impact the indoor climate. By monitoring these variables, heat timer systems can adjust the heating output to compensate for these changes. This ensures a consistent and comfortable temperature inside the building, regardless of what’s happening outside.

    In addition to energy savings and improved comfort, heat timer automatic heating control also offers convenience and ease of use. These systems can be programmed and customized to suit individual preferences and schedules. For example, users can set different temperature settings for different times of the day, or even adjust the temperature remotely using a smartphone or tablet. This level of control allows users to create a personalized heating schedule that meets their specific needs.

    Moreover, heat timer automatic heating control can also extend the lifespan of heating equipment. By operating more efficiently and preventing unnecessary wear and tear, these systems can help to reduce maintenance costs and extend the longevity of the heating system. This can be particularly beneficial for commercial buildings, where heating systems are often subjected to heavy use and require regular upkeep.

    Overall, heat timer automatic heating control is a smart investment for any building owner or manager looking to improve energy efficiency, save costs, and enhance comfort. Whether it’s a residential home, office building, or retail space, these systems can make a significant difference in how heating is managed and controlled.

    In conclusion, heat timer automatic heating control offers a host of benefits, including energy savings, improved comfort, convenience, and increased equipment lifespan. By utilizing advanced technology and automation, these systems provide a more efficient and effective way to regulate indoor temperature. Whether you’re looking to reduce heating costs or enhance occupant comfort, heat timer automatic heating control is a wise choice for any building.   • How To Remove A Renter From Your Property

    Renting out a property can be a lucrative venture, but it can also come with its fair share of challenges One of the most dreaded situations for any landlord is dealing with a tenant who refuses to leave Whether they have fallen behind on rent, violated the terms of the lease, or simply overstayed their welcome, getting a renter out of your house can be a daunting task However, there are legal steps you can take to ensure a smooth and efficient eviction process.

    The first and most important step in removing a renter from your property is to familiarize yourself with the landlord-tenant laws in your state These laws outline the rights and responsibilities of both landlords and tenants, as well as the proper procedures for eviction It is crucial to follow these laws to the letter to avoid any unnecessary complications or delays in the eviction process.

    Before taking any action, you should also review the terms of the lease agreement that you have with the renter This document will outline the grounds for eviction and the notice period required before taking legal action If the renter is in violation of the lease or has failed to pay rent, you may have legal grounds for eviction.

    The next step is to provide the renter with a formal notice of eviction This notice should be in writing and clearly state the reason for the eviction, as well as the date by which the renter must vacate the property The notice period will vary depending on the laws in your state, so be sure to consult with an attorney or local housing authority to ensure that you are following the correct procedures.

    If the renter refuses to leave after receiving the eviction notice, you may need to file an eviction lawsuit in court how do you get a renter out of your house. This process can be time-consuming and expensive, so it is best to exhaust all other options before taking this step Keep in mind that you cannot use self-help measures, such as changing the locks or removing the renter’s belongings, to force them out of the property Doing so could result in legal repercussions for you as the landlord.

    Once the eviction lawsuit has been filed, the renter will have the opportunity to respond and present their case in court If the judge rules in your favor, they will issue an order for the renter to vacate the property within a specified timeframe If the renter still refuses to leave, you may need to enlist the help of law enforcement to physically remove them from the premises.

    It is important to handle the eviction process with professionalism and empathy, as emotions can run high during these situations Keep communication lines open with the renter and be prepared to offer assistance in finding alternative housing if necessary Remember that evicting a renter should always be a last resort, and it is in everyone’s best interest to resolve the situation amicably if possible.

    In conclusion, getting a renter out of your house can be a complicated and stressful process, but it is essential to follow the proper legal procedures to protect your rights as a landlord By familiarizing yourself with the landlord-tenant laws in your state, providing formal notice of eviction, and seeking legal assistance if needed, you can ensure a smooth and efficient eviction process Remember to handle the situation with professionalism and compassion, and always prioritize clear communication with the renter throughout the process.

    By following these steps, you can navigate the eviction process successfully and regain control of your property in a timely manner.

  • The Importance Of Refuge Areas For Wildlife Conservation

    refuge areas play a crucial role in wildlife conservation efforts around the world. These designated areas provide safe havens for a wide range of species, allowing them to thrive without the threats posed by human activities. By creating and protecting refuge areas, conservationists can help preserve biodiversity, protect endangered species, and ensure the long-term survival of ecosystems.

    One of the primary purposes of refuge areas is to provide a sanctuary for wildlife that is facing threats in their natural habitats. These threats can come in many forms, including habitat destruction, pollution, poaching, and climate change. By setting aside specific areas where wildlife can live without fear of these threats, conservationists can help ensure the survival of species that are at risk of extinction.

    refuge areas are also important for maintaining healthy ecosystems. By protecting certain areas from human exploitation, natural processes can continue uninterrupted. This allows wildlife to move freely, find food and shelter, and reproduce without interference. In turn, these healthy ecosystems provide benefits for humans as well, such as clean air and water, pollination services, and protection from natural disasters.

    In addition to providing a safe haven for wildlife, refuge areas also play a key role in research and education efforts. Scientists can study the behavior and habitat requirements of species within these protected areas, gaining valuable insights that can inform conservation strategies. Educators can also use these areas as outdoor classrooms, teaching students about the importance of biodiversity and the need to protect natural habitats.

    There are many different types of refuge areas, each serving a specific purpose in wildlife conservation. National parks and wildlife reserves, for example, are typically large areas of land set aside for the protection of plants and animals. These areas often have strict regulations in place to limit human activities and protect sensitive habitats.

    Marine protected areas are another important type of refuge area, designed to conserve ocean ecosystems and the species that rely on them. These areas can include coral reefs, seagrass beds, and deep-sea habitats, providing vital protection for marine biodiversity. By safeguarding these areas, conservationists can help ensure the health of the world’s oceans and the creatures that inhabit them.

    Local community-based conservation areas are also becoming more popular as a way to involve people in the protection of wildlife. These areas are often managed by local communities, who have a vested interest in preserving their natural resources. By working with these communities, conservationists can create sustainable solutions that benefit both people and wildlife.

    Despite the many benefits of refuge areas, they are not without their challenges. Encroachment by human activities, such as agriculture, mining, and urban development, can threaten the integrity of these protected areas. Illegal poaching and logging can also pose a significant risk to wildlife within refuge areas, putting endangered species in even greater danger.

    To address these threats, conservationists must work diligently to enforce regulations, monitor wildlife populations, and engage with local communities to promote sustainable practices. By building partnerships with governments, businesses, and local stakeholders, conservationists can ensure the long-term success of refuge areas and the species that depend on them.

    In conclusion, refuge areas play a vital role in wildlife conservation efforts around the world. These protected areas provide safe havens for species facing threats in their natural habitats, support healthy ecosystems, and serve as valuable research and education resources. By safeguarding refuge areas and the species that inhabit them, conservationists can make a significant impact on global biodiversity and ensure a sustainable future for both wildlife and humans.

  • Creating A Sacred Space: The Importance Of A Catholic Prayer Room In The House

    In the hustle and bustle of daily life, it can be challenging to find moments of peace and reflection However, having a designated space in your house for prayer and meditation can provide solace, comfort, and a connection to the divine For Catholics, a prayer room serves as a sanctuary for worship, reflection, and communion with God Let’s explore the significance of a Catholic prayer room in the house and how to create a sacred space that fosters spiritual growth and renewal.

    The concept of a prayer room or chapel within the home has been a longstanding tradition in Catholic households This sacred space is intended for personal and communal prayer, contemplation, and devotion Having a dedicated area for prayer allows individuals to set aside distractions and focus on their spiritual life It serves as a reminder of the importance of prayer in daily living and provides a sanctuary for seeking guidance, peace, and strength from God.

    The design and décor of a Catholic prayer room can vary depending on personal preferences and traditions Some may choose to adorn the space with religious symbols, such as crucifixes, statues, candles, and paintings of saints Others may prefer a minimalist approach with simple furnishings and a quiet ambiance for reflection Whatever the style may be, the key is to create a tranquil and sacred atmosphere that invites reverence and contemplation.

    When setting up a Catholic prayer room in your house, consider the following elements to enhance the spiritual experience:

    1 Choose a quiet and secluded location: Select a room or corner in your house that is free from distractions and noise This will allow you to focus on prayer and meditation without interruptions Ideally, the prayer room should be a peaceful retreat where you can retreat from the busyness of everyday life and connect with God.

    2 Create an altar or focal point: Designate a space within the prayer room for an altar or focal point where you can place religious items, such as a Bible, crucifix, rosary beads, or sacred artwork catholic prayer room in house. This area serves as a visual reminder of God’s presence and can help center your mind and heart during prayer.

    3 Incorporate sacred imagery and symbols: Decorate the prayer room with religious imagery and symbols that hold personal significance to you Whether it’s a painting of the Virgin Mary, a statue of Saint Francis, or a depiction of the Last Supper, these visual aids can inspire devotion and contemplation.

    4 Include comfortable seating and lighting: Ensure that the prayer room is equipped with comfortable seating, such as a prayer kneeler, cushions, or a meditation bench Good lighting is also essential for creating a calming ambiance and setting the right mood for prayer and reflection.

    5 Establish a prayer routine: Set aside regular times each day to spend in prayer and meditation in your prayer room This consistency will help cultivate a habit of prayer and deepen your relationship with God over time Consider incorporating traditional Catholic prayers, such as the Our Father, Hail Mary, and Rosary, into your daily devotions.

    Having a Catholic prayer room in the house not only strengthens one’s spiritual life but also fosters a sense of community and connection with God It serves as a sacred space where family members can come together to pray, worship, and support each other in their faith journey Additionally, a prayer room can be a place of solace and comfort during challenging times, providing a source of hope and reassurance in the face of adversity.

    In conclusion, a Catholic prayer room in the house is a valuable resource for nurturing one’s spiritual growth and deepening their relationship with God By creating a sacred space for prayer and meditation, individuals can find peace, strength, and guidance in their daily lives Whether it’s a small corner or a dedicated room, a prayer room serves as a sanctuary for seeking God’s presence and grace Let us embrace the tradition of having a Catholic prayer room in the house and commit to making prayer a central part of our lives.

  • The Benefits Of Vacuum Formed Products

    When it comes to creating custom plastic products, vacuum forming is a popular and versatile manufacturing process. vacuum formed products are used in a wide variety of industries, from automotive to medical to packaging. So, what exactly are vacuum formed products and how are they made?

    Vacuum forming is a type of thermoforming process where a plastic sheet is heated until it becomes pliable and then draped over a mold. A vacuum is then applied to the mold, sucking the heated plastic sheet tightly against it. Once the plastic cools and hardens, it retains the shape of the mold and can be trimmed to create the final product.

    One of the primary benefits of vacuum formed products is their cost-effectiveness. Compared to other manufacturing processes like injection molding, vacuum forming is relatively inexpensive, especially for low to medium production runs. This makes it an attractive option for companies looking to create custom plastic products without breaking the bank.

    Another advantage of vacuum formed products is their versatility. Vacuum forming can be used to create products of almost any size and shape, from small containers to large panels. Additionally, vacuum forming is compatible with a wide range of materials, including ABS, polycarbonate, and PETG, allowing for greater flexibility in design and production.

    One industry where vacuum formed products are particularly popular is the automotive industry. Vacuum formed plastic parts are used in a variety of applications, from interior trim panels to exterior body panels. The lightweight and durable nature of vacuum formed plastic makes it an ideal material for automotive components, helping to improve fuel efficiency and reduce overall vehicle weight.

    In the medical industry, vacuum formed products are used to create a wide range of disposable and reusable medical devices and equipment. The ability to produce custom products quickly and cost-effectively makes vacuum forming an ideal manufacturing process for medical applications where precision and cleanliness are paramount.

    Packaging is another industry where vacuum formed products play a crucial role. Vacuum formed plastic trays and clamshells are commonly used to protect and display a wide range of products, from electronics to food items. The ability to create custom packaging solutions with vacuum forming ensures that products are safely packaged and presented to consumers in an attractive and functional manner.

    Overall, vacuum formed products offer a wide range of benefits, from cost-effectiveness to versatility to efficiency. By utilizing vacuum forming, companies can create custom plastic products that are tailored to their specific needs and requirements. Whether it’s automotive components, medical devices, or packaging solutions, vacuum formed products are a reliable and effective option for manufacturers looking to bring their ideas to life.

    In conclusion, vacuum formed products are a valuable resource for companies looking to produce custom plastic products in a cost-effective and efficient manner. With their versatility, durability, and wide range of applications, vacuum formed products are a smart choice for industries ranging from automotive to medical to packaging. The next time you need a custom plastic product, consider the benefits of vacuum forming and see how it can help bring your ideas to life.

  • A Breakdown Of Different Types Of Packaging Materials

    When it comes to packaging products, there are a variety of materials to choose from Each material has its own unique properties that make it suitable for different types of products From protecting fragile items to preserving food, the right packaging material is crucial for the safety and quality of the product Let’s take a look at some of the most common types of packaging materials used today.

    1 Cardboard: Cardboard is one of the most widely used packaging materials due to its versatility and cost-effectiveness It is lightweight yet sturdy, making it an ideal choice for shipping and storing goods Cardboard boxes come in various sizes and shapes, making them suitable for a wide range of products They can also be easily customized with logos and designs, making them perfect for branding purposes.

    2 Plastic: Plastic is another popular packaging material that is commonly used for food items, beverages, and personal care products It is lightweight, flexible, and durable, making it perfect for protecting products from moisture and contamination Plastic packaging also offers high transparency, allowing consumers to see the product inside However, the environmental impact of plastic packaging is a growing concern due to its non-biodegradable nature.

    3 Glass: Glass packaging is preferred for products that require a high level of protection, such as beverages, cosmetics, and pharmaceuticals Glass is impermeable to air and moisture, ensuring the freshness and quality of the product inside It is also recyclable and can be reused multiple times, making it an environmentally friendly option However, glass packaging is heavier and more fragile than plastic or cardboard, making it less cost-effective for shipping.

    4 Metal: Metal packaging is commonly used for canned food, beverages, and aerosol products It is highly durable and can withstand high temperatures, making it suitable for products that require long-term preservation different types of packaging materials. Metal cans are also airtight, keeping the contents fresh and free from contamination However, metal packaging is heavier and more expensive than other materials, making it less popular for lightweight products.

    5 Paper: Paper packaging is a versatile option that is used for a variety of products, including food, clothing, and gifts It is biodegradable and recyclable, making it an eco-friendly choice for environmentally conscious consumers Paper bags, boxes, and pouches can be customized with different finishes and designs, making them ideal for branding and marketing purposes However, paper packaging is not as durable as plastic or metal, making it unsuitable for products that require high protection.

    6 Foam: Foam packaging is commonly used for fragile items such as electronics, glassware, and ceramics It provides cushioning and shock absorption, protecting delicate products from damage during shipping and handling Foam packaging can be custom-cut to fit the specific dimensions of the product, ensuring a snug and secure fit However, foam packaging is not biodegradable and can be difficult to recycle, leading to environmental concerns.

    7 Wood: Wood packaging is often used for heavy-duty products such as machinery, equipment, and furniture It is strong, durable, and can withstand rough handling and extreme weather conditions Wooden crates, pallets, and skids provide excellent protection and stability for large and bulky items However, wood packaging is heavy and expensive, making it less suitable for lightweight products.

    In conclusion, the choice of packaging material plays a crucial role in ensuring the safety, quality, and presentation of a product Each type of packaging material has its own unique properties and characteristics that make it suitable for different products and purposes Whether you are shipping fragile items, preserving food, or branding your product, there is a packaging material that meets your needs By understanding the strengths and limitations of each material, you can make an informed decision on the most suitable packaging solution for your product.
